Hear hear HAK, but newcomers please be aware we don't advocate debt avoidance on here.

What we do advocate is empowering yourselves to deal with your debts, and debt collectors, according to the law. If whoever is chasing you goes by the book, and all your documentation from the bank is in order, we can point you in the right direction to get free, managed help from a debt management organisation.

If your documentation, eg loan agreement, is missing or faulty, if you have had unfair penalty charges added to your account, or if DCA's break the rules..we can advise, but ultimately it's your decision how to proceed.

Most of all, though, whatever your circumstances, on here you will get NON JUDGEMENTAL support, a warm welcome and new friends who understand your problems...because they're in the same boat.:)
